Output 7b81c2affa22a78fb8f7e5158bd274e0fdff9600e5bb287199ff73634dcd047e:0

value
622503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 157621018416e80361914b92ba741d20a9ccbfed OP_EQUAL
address
33eVdKAsqk3bJxqR5UacH9YbfLHLSD7Y76
transaction
7b81c2affa22a78fb8f7e5158bd274e0fdff9600e5bb287199ff73634dcd047e
confirmations
110603
spent
true